John and Orpha Hooge
Orpha Brenner and Joen E. Hooge, Munich, North Dakota, were married March
18, 1944, in the Mt. Zion Baptist Church north of Lyona while John was on
furlough. He was stationed in Centerville, Mississippi, with the 150th General
Hospital serving as assistant to the chaplain.
In July 1944, John was sent to the South Pacific where he served in New
Guinea and the Philippines. Orpha taught the Fairview and Carry Creek Schools
during his absence. After his discharge from the Army John completed his
collete and seminary training.
John pastored Baptist churches in Wellsville and Fort Scott, Kansas, and
since 1960 John and Orpha have lived in the Kearney, Nebraska area where he
has served as pastor of several churches.
Orpha completed college and for twelve years was a cataloger in the Kearney
State College Library, retiring in 1980.
Their children are: Donald, Coeru D.Alene, Idaho; John R. and David,
Lawrence, Kansas; and Carol O'Neill, Axtell, Nebraska. Grandchildren are Jenea
and John-David Hooge and Broke O'Neill.
Don is not married; JOhn R. married Claudia Helm; David married Pat Temm,
and Carol married Paul J. O'Neill.
John and Orpha live in Juniata, Nebraska.
